Okay freepers, I need your comments. On Tuesday I went on my weekly shop at our local supermarket here in Orlando and something happened to me that has never happened before and I'm curious as to your opinions.

In a package of pudding cups I bought I found that religious prayer cards (christian) had been inserted inside. Then, I opened up a loaf of bread and found that a large black foreign object had been baked into the loaf. Today, I went to the fridge to get a soda and the next can in my pack was completely EMPTY. The can had a small puncture hole in the the bottom, but there is no evidence that the can leaked after it was put in the box.

I'm beginning to get wierded out. Has anyone else had 3 cases of food product contamination like this occur.....they all seem unrelated, but what are the chances of all 3 happening from the same shopping trip??? Also, I've contacted the bread company and returned the pudding to the store (who basically blew me off as a whacko). Should I call the soda company as well? Thanks.

Is this a chain or an independent store? If it's a chain, I'd contact the corporate headquarters, and send them a letter explaining that the Orlanda store at such-and-such address "blows off" consumer reports of product tampering.

I would also contact the bread and soda companies. Most likely , it's sheer coincidence that you got two effed up pieces of produce, but it's just barely conceivable that there is something more going on here, and this was a test run. Not necessarily terrorism, though...Remember the tylenol killings?

As for the pudding pamphlet, that's probably nothing. There are people out there who do nothing but run around sticking that stuff into magazines for sell, produce, library books...This is especially true of Jack Chick's stuff.
